• 2026 Shore Conference Boys Soccer Preview: Class B South (shoresportsinsider.com) — Lacey Township High School's boys soccer team is projected as a top contender in the Shore Conference's Class B South after an injury-plagued 2025 season. With standout goalkeeper Dylan Graham healthy again and several young players returning with varsity experience, the Lions aim to turn last year's hard lessons into a deeper postseason run against rivals like Jackson, Central, Point Beach, Brick, and Manchester.
